+ftplib
+------
+
+The :class:`~ftplib.FTP_TLS` class now provides a new
+:func:`~ftplib.FTP_TLS.ccc` function to revert control channel back to
+plaintex. This can be useful to take advantage of firewalls that know how to
+handle NAT with non-secure FTP without opening fixed ports.
+
+(Patch submitted by Giampaolo Rodolà in :issue:`12139`.)

diff --git a/Lib/ftplib.py b/Lib/ftplib.py
--- a/Lib/ftplib.py
+++ b/Lib/ftplib.py
@@ -708,6 +708,14 @@
 self.file = self.sock.makefile(mode='r', encoding=self.encoding)
 return resp
 
+ def ccc(self):
+ '''Switch back to a clear-text control connection.'''
+ if not isinstance(self.sock, ssl.SSLSocket):
+ raise ValueError("not using TLS")
+ resp = self.voidcmd('CCC')
+ self.sock = self.sock.unwrap()
+ return resp
+
